Вопросы с тегом «environment-variables»

Переменные среды - это набор динамических именованных значений, которые могут влиять на поведение запущенных процессов на компьютере.

6
Отключить утверждения в Python
На этот вопрос есть ответы на Stack Overflow на русском : Есть ли возможность отключить assert? Как отключить утверждения в Python? То есть, если утверждение терпит неудачу, я не хочу, чтобы оно бросало AssertionError, а чтобы оно продолжалось. Как я могу это сделать?


7
getenv () против $ _ENV в PHP
В чем разница между getenv()и $_ENV? Есть ли компромиссы между их использованием? Я заметил, что иногда getenv()дает мне то, что мне нужно, а $_ENVне дает (например HOME).

7
Kubernetes-эквивалент env-файла в Docker
Задний план: В настоящее время мы используем Docker и Docker Compose для наших сервисов. Мы перенесли конфигурацию для различных сред в файлы, которые определяют переменные среды, считываемые приложением. Например prod.envфайл: ENV_VAR_ONE=Something Prod ENV_VAR_TWO=Something else Prod и test.envфайл: ENV_VAR_ONE=Something Test ENV_VAR_TWO=Something else Test Таким образом, мы можем просто использовать файл prod.envили …

4
Как включить virtualenv в служебном модуле systemd?
Я хочу «активировать» виртуальный сервер в служебном файле systemd. Я бы не хотел, чтобы между процессом systemd и интерпретатором python был процесс оболочки. Мое текущее решение выглядит так: [Unit] Description=fooservice After=syslog.target network.target [Service] Type=simple User=fooservice WorkingDirectory={{ venv_home }} ExecStart={{ venv_home }}/fooservice --serve-in-foreground Restart=on-abort EnvironmentFile=/etc/sysconfig/fooservice.env [Install] WantedBy=multi-user.target /etc/sysconfig/fooservice.env PATH={{ venv_home }}/bin:/usr/local/bin:/usr/bin:/bin …

9
Переменная среды с Maven
Я перенес проект из Eclipse в Maven, и мне нужно установить переменную среды, чтобы мой проект заработал. В Eclipse я перехожу к «Выполнить -> Выполнить конфигурации» и на вкладке «Среда» устанавливаю для «WSNSHELL_HOME» значение «conf». Как я могу это сделать с Maven? Большое спасибо!

3
Что делает команда «экспорт»?
Я немного новичок в Linux, и мне довелось запускать некоторые команды вслепую, чтобы добиться желаемого. Я подумал, что задавать подобные вопросы не будет напрасной тратой, поскольку новые люди будут регулярно знать о них. Недавно я начал работать с Дженкинсом , а затем мне пришлось использовать эту exportкоманду для запуска военного …

7
Каков максимальный размер значения переменной среды?
Есть ли ограничение на объем данных, которые могут храниться в переменной среды в Linux, и если да, то что это такое? Для Windows я нашел следующую статью базы знаний, которая резюмирует: Windows XP или новее: 8191 символ Windows 2000 / NT 4.0: 2047 символов

2
Как правильно отключить переменную среды Linux в Python?
Из документации: Если платформа поддерживает эту unsetenv()функцию, вы можете удалить элементы в этом сопоставлении, чтобы сбросить переменные среды. unsetenv()будет вызываться автоматически при удалении элемента из os.environ и при вызове одного из методов pop()или clear(). Однако я хочу что-то, что будет работать независимо от наличия unsetenv(). Как удалить элементы из сопоставления, …

4
Использовать переменные среды в CMD
Могу ли я использовать переменные среды в разделе CMD в файле Dockerfile? Я хочу сделать что-то вроде этого: CMD ["myserver", "--arg=$ARG", "--memcache=$MEMCACHE_11211_TCP_ADDR:$MEMCACHE_11211_TCP_PORT"] Где $ MEMCACHE_11211_TCP_ * будет устанавливаться автоматически путем включения параметра --link моей docker runкоманды. И $ ARG может настраиваться пользователем во время выполнения, может быть, с помощью параметра …

5
Глобальные переменные среды в сценарии оболочки
Как установить глобальную переменную среды в сценарии bash? Если я сделаю что-то вроде #!/bin/bash FOO=bar ...или же #!/bin/bash export FOO=bar ... похоже, что вары остаются в локальном контексте, тогда как я хотел бы продолжать использовать их после завершения выполнения скрипта.

5
Свойство firebase не существует для типа {production: boolean; }
Итак, я пытался создать и развернуть приложение Angular 4 для производства как на Firebase, так и на Heroku, но обнаружил следующую ошибку: ОШИБКА в / Users / ... / ... (57,49): свойство 'firebase' не существует для типа '{production: boolean; } '. Это происходит, когда я запускаю ng build --prod, и …

1
Как установить переменную среды GOPRIVATE
Я начал работать над Goпроектом, и он использует некоторые приватные модули из частных репозиториев Github, и всякий раз, когда я пытаюсь его запустить, go run main.goвыдается следующее сообщение 410 Goneоб ошибке: проверка github.com/repoURL/go-proto@v2.86.0+incompatible/go.mod: github.com/repoURL/go-proto@v2.86.0+incompatible/go.mod: чтение https: //sum.golang. org/lookup/github.com/!repoURL/go-proto@v2.86.0+совместимо : 410 Gone Я могу легко клонировать приватное репо из терминала, что …
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.